Block Inc. Discloses $2.2 Billion in Bitcoin Holdings
28 Apr 2026 · 07:45 UTC · The Block · Original source
Summary
Block Inc. disclosed that it held 28,355 BTC, valued at approximately $2.2 billion, as of March 31, 2026, including customer assets held by the company. This disclosure provides insight into Block's strategic bitcoin allocation and demonstrates growing institutional adoption of the asset by major technology and financial services companies.
